December in Beaufort, United States, presents a dynamic range of temperatures, with daytime highs averaging 26°C (79°F), while nights can dip to a chilly -3°C (26°F). The overall average temperature settles around a cool 12°C (54°F), making layers a necessity for outdoor activities. Rainfall contributes significantly to the month's ambiance, with 116 mm (4.6 in) of precipitation spread over 9 days, showcasing the region’s characteristic 87% humidity. As December rolls in, Beaufort experiences a notable uptick in humidity, peaking at 87%. This marks a consistent trend where winter months tend to bring higher moisture levels, with January following closely at 86% and November at 85%. Interestingly, the humidity dips during the late spring and early summer, reaching its low point of 75% in both May and June. However, as the year winds down, humidity levels again rise, showcasing Beaufort’s characteristic moist climate that further intensifies in the cooler months. In Beaufort, United States, daylight duration exhibits a captivating rhythm throughout the year, starting from 10 hours in January and peaking at 14 hours in June and July. As summer gives way to autumn, the days gradually shorten, with November and December both returning to 10 hours of daylight.
